  • Patent number: 5043655
    Abstract: A current sensing buffer 26 for driving a digital signal line of a unit under test 12 is composed of current mirror circuits in series with output switching transistors supplying test signals to the digital signal line. The current mirror circuits 66, 72 and 80, 84 generate sample currents corresponding to the magnitude of current through the respective drivers 68 and 78 to detect drive faults caused by bus or component failures. In buses comprised of several digital signal lines, one current sensing buffer 26 is used per line, and each curent sensing buffer 26 is controlled by a programmable circuit tester 10. The current sensing buffer 26 can be incorporated into an interface pod 14 which is substituted for a control component of a unit under test 12.

  • Patent number: 4539550
    Abstract: The ladder network of a recirculation of remainder analog to digital converter has pairs of controlled switches connected alternately to a voltage source and a ground, to establish unidirectional current flow through the switches. Unidirectional current flow eliminates ladder error caused by current flow direction resistances inherent in the switches.

  • Patent number: 4535318
    Abstract: A calibration circuit for a recirculation of remainder analog-to-digital (A/D) converter heuristically solves a multiple variable conversion equation. Input analog calibration and analog reference signals are compared in a comparator, and when the two signals have a predetermined relationship, the comparator generates an indicator signal. A microprocessor determines a first pattern of digital reference signals that, together with digital calibration signals generated by the microprocessor, causes the comparator to generate the indicator signal and a second pattern of digital reference signals that, together with the input analog calibration signals, causes the comparator to generate the indicator signal. The difference between the first and second patterns of digital reference signals is stored as conversion coefficients.
